Cycling routes from Forges-les-Bains

Forges-les-Bains is a charming locality located in the Ile-de-France region of France. From a cyclist's perspective, Forges-les-Bains offers a picturesque and peaceful environment for road and gravel cycling. The surrounding countryside is adorned with beautiful landscapes, perfect for exploring on two wheels. While Forges-les-Bains may not have any famous cycling-related spots or well-known climbs nearby, it provides cyclists with the opportunity to discover lesser-known but equally stunning routes.

Explore the scenic Haute Vallée de l'Yvette on this gravel adventure

gravel
101 km
976 m
Tough

Embark on a memorable gravel adventure through the picturesque Haute Vallée de l'Yvette. This route offers a challenging yet rewarding experience, with a total ascent of 976 meters over a distance of 101 kilometers. Start your journey in Forges-les-Bains and discover the natural beauty of the region as you pedal through enchanting forests, charming villages, and rolling countryside. The route takes you past several highlights, including the historical Chevreuse, the panoramic viewpoint at Gif-sur-Yvette, and the scenic Roussigny.

Experience the beauty of Ile-de-France on this scenic road loop

road
136 km
641 m
Tough

Immerse yourself in the captivating landscapes of Ile-de-France as you embark on this scenic road loop starting near Forges-les-Bains. With a total ascent of 641 meters over a distance of 136 kilometers, this route offers a satisfying challenge for experienced cyclists. Enjoy picturesque views along the way and discover charming towns and landmarks, including the iconic Viaduc des Fauvettes, the peaceful Les Ulis, and the historical Antony. Take a break at the scenic viewpoints of Butte de Thiais and Champigny-sur-Marne, and explore the quaint town of Pontault-Combault. This road loop showcases the diverse beauty of Ile-de-France and is a must-do for any cycling enthusiast.
